Pocket reduction surgery, also referred to as osseous surgery, is designed to address the issue of deep gum pockets formed by periodontal disease. Over time, plaque and tartar buildup can create these pockets, making it difficult for at-home care and regular cleanings to keep your gums healthy. During pocket reduction surgery, the periodontist carefully folds back the gum tissue, removes bacteria and tartar, and then repositions the gums to fit snugly around the teeth. This process not only reduces the depth of the pockets but also promotes healing and healthier gum tissue.

Root amputation, often referred to as hemisection, is a targeted surgical intervention designed to save a tooth affected by severe periodontal disease or injury. This procedure involves the removal of one or more roots of a multi-rooted tooth while leaving the remaining roots and the crown intact. Here are some critical scenarios where root amputation might be the best approach:

  • Severe Infection: When a tooth experiences significant infection at its root, amputation can prevent the spread of bacteria to surrounding tissues, helping to preserve the tooth and maintain overall oral health.
  • Extensive Damage: In cases where one root of a tooth is compromised while the other remains healthy, root amputation allows for the damaged portion to be removed, ultimately extending the life of the tooth.
  • Periodontal Disease Management: For patients suffering from advanced gum disease, this procedure can be a part of an overall strategy to enhance gum health and prevent further damage.

What Causes Gum Recession and How Is It Treated?

Posted on

Gum recession is a prevalent dental issue that can significantly impact oral health if left untreated. Several factors can lead to gum recession, including:

  • Periodontal Disease: Bacterial infections that damage the soft tissue and bone supporting the teeth can cause gum loss.
  • Genetics: Some individuals are genetically predisposed to gum disease and recession.
  • Overbrushing: Aggressive brushing with hard-bristled toothbrushes can wear down the gum tissue over time.
  • Hormonal Changes: Hormonal fluctuations, especially in women during puberty, pregnancy, or menopause, can increase gum sensitivity and recession.
  • Tobacco Use: Smoking or using other tobacco products can negatively affect gum health.

The complications arising from gum recession include increased tooth sensitivity, a higher risk of cavities, and tooth loss if the problem worsens. Treatment options available for gum recession vary depending on the severity and root causes. Some effective treatments include:

  • Scaling and Root Planing: This deep-cleaning method involves removing plaque and tartar buildup below the gum line.
  • Gum Grafting: A procedure where tissue is taken from another part of the mouth or obtained from a donor to cover exposed roots.
  • Pinhole Surgical Technique: A minimally invasive approach that allows the repositioning of the gum tissue without the need for grafting.

Scaling and root planing are foundational procedures that help improve gum health and reverse the effects of gum disease. Scaling involves the removal of plaque and tartar from above and below the gum line, ensuring that harmful bacteria are eliminated. Root planing, on the other hand, smooths the root surfaces to promote healing and facilitate reattachment of gums to the teeth. Patients often find these procedures result in reduced inflammation and improved gum health, creating a favorable environment for healing.
